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Stewart
United KingdomThe riad is perfectly located in the Medina. Its locates down a small alley way, which means u have peace and quiet, but only a short walk and you are in amongst the hustle and bustle of Medina life and the souks. The main square is approx 15mins walk through the souks. The room i had was a good size( double bed &, 1 single).aircon worked well and a small en-suite shower. It was clean and tidy. I ate both nights there and food was delicious and value for money. And the option of eating on rooftop. It alos has sun loungerd if you fancy a day relaxing. Staff are super friendly, will help with anything and its never an issue.will always offer advice on the best places to visit. I was 2 days here after and for the cost and location and staff id happily stay again

Tamara
United KingdomI wish we had been told it was possible to eat breakfast on the rooftop, I discovered it myself, but no matter as breakfast inside was also nice. Children's beds are very soft. I didn't manage to have a hot shower in the morning. Not a big problem as it's hot in Marrakech in August but my back hurt so I would have liked one.
Very pretty interior. Great communication & organisation of airport transfer. Delicious breakfast, can have it on rooftop as well as downstairs. Rooms are also pretty & good lighting as little natural light with riad design to keep it cool. In fact the rooms stay so cool that Aircon is barely necessary, though they do provide it of course. Rooftop is lovely with sunbeds. Close to souks & walkable to Jardín Majorelle. Other guests were respectful of the quiet hours.
